Radiative Corrections to Casimir Effect in the $\lambda\phi^{4}$ Model

High Energy Physics - Theory 2007-05-23 v1

Abstract

We calculate radiative corrections to the Casimir effect for the massive complex scalar field with the λϕ4\lambda\phi^{4} self-interaction in d+1d+1 dimensions. We consider the field submitted to four types of boundary conditions on two parallel planes, namely: (i) quasi-periodic boundary conditions, which interpolates continuously periodic and anti-periodic ones, (ii) Dirichlet conditions on both planes, (iii) Neumann conditions on both planes and (iv) mixed conditions, that is, Dirichlet on one plane and Neumann on the other one.
